SHORT ANSWER:
President's Rule leads to the central government taking over the state's governance, affecting the distribution of powers.
DETAILS:
- Imposed under Article 356 of the Constitution of India.
- The state government is dissolved, and the central government administers the state.
- Legislative powers of the state are transferred to the Parliament.
PUNISHMENT / IMPLICATIONS (if applicable):
- The state loses its autonomy and legislative powers temporarily.
- Elections must be held within six months to restore the state government.
